The identity verification process begins with document upload, where users submit identification documents through a secure platform. These documents include passport, driver's license, national ID, residence permit, work permit, social security card, or health insurance card - totaling over 2,500 document types across 195 countries. The platform supports document verification through optical character recognition (OCR) technology, extracting relevant information to verify document authenticity.
For biometric authentication, users complete a selfie that is compared to the photo on their ID document to confirm identity. The system employs liveness detection technology to verify that the presented face is live and not a static image, preventing attempts to use fraudulent documents or photos. In addition to these core checks, the platform applies fraud detection algorithms to identify potential risks and suspicious activities, providing an additional layer of security for every transaction.

The Onfido Fraud Lab drives continuous development through real-world testing, with capabilities including accurate benchmarking, tracking emerging threats, and forecasting future risks. The laboratory generates thousands of fraud samples and synthetic identities, supporting training for Atlas AI's 10,000+ micro-models. Document verification testing covers 2,500 document types from over 100 countries, while biometric verification analyzes 2D and 3D masks, photos, printouts, and deep fakes across global data samples.
The Fraud Lab powers two key solutions: Onfido Motion, a fully automated biometric verification solution meeting iBeta PAD Level 2 standards, returning 95% of verifications in under 10 seconds. It combines field-collected and generated data for robust training. The Known Faces system flags previously seen identities, while Repeat Attempts detects organized fraud patterns without adding friction for legitimate users.
Onfido's approach to device intelligence analyzes network information including IP address, geolocation, and device metadata to identify sophisticated fraud attempts.
